What is Bronchoscopy?

It is procedure to reach the lungs to examine the airways. It is performed with the help of a thin tube called bronchoscope. It is inserted through nose or mouth to reach the lungs.

Treatment of Bronchoscopy

During the procedure, a bronchoscope is inserted into nose or mouth to get a biopsy, an electrocautery test to control bleeding or a laser to reduce the size of an airway tumor or for any other purpose.

Risks of Bronchoscopy

May include:

  • Bleeding
  • Lung Collapse
  • Fever
